I can't fix pose of charactor too much , because I model them in final pose
You know, I had this same problem with my characters and I think I found a good solution that is pretty quick. In your 3d app, simply detach the limbs that you want to repose. Detach them at the shoulder and at the elbow. Then, repose the detached limbs to your liking. Next, reattach the limbs. Now some tweaking will need to take place. To do this quickly, simply bring the model into zbrush and sculpt the joints with the move tool until you're satisfied. The whole process shouldn't take more than 20-30 minutes maximum I think.

Looks great! The texture work is superb.
I think you need to do something with the composition though - its extremely busy at the moment and the eye doesnt know where to focus. The detail of the textures, combined with the geometry and overall sharpness makes it hard to make out at a glance. Try defocusing some areas, adding a vignette, some BG mist or dust and maybe alter the lighting so that shadows and sihlouettes will help seporate the characters from the background. Maybe change the sky too - the whiteness of the clouds 'merge' with the whiteness of the girls' face.
Sorry to drop a big crit on you like that at this point in time, but i think the only problem with this right now is its sharpness and the busy-ness of the composition.

Nice texturing and design, Im not sure how far you have gone with lighting or what rendering style you are aiming toward, but I feel the lighting lacks drama, and seeing as this peice has quite a bit of drama, you really want to show it off :) perhaps look at tieing in the stormy sky into your lighting more, which might give you a bit more contrast in the scene. Another Thing is your skin shaders, although these characters wear make-up it would be nice to see a bit more depth to the skin even slightly. Maybe try making your wood a touch more glossy and your cloth have a bit of falloff toward the edges.
Other than that modelling, texturing and posing are all great!
PS : motion blur would work a treat on the coins/tokens especially!!!, but if you added it to the whole scene subtley it wouldnt hurt.
